No traffic gravel bike trails around Alfstedt are found within the North German lowlands, characterized by a diverse "Geest" landscape. This terrain offers a mix of sandy paths, forests, heathland, moor, and agricultural land, providing varied surfaces ideal for gravel biking. The region is shaped by the gentle Oste River Valley and features significant natural areas like Vörder Lake and extensive moor landscapes. These features create a network of routes suitable for exploring away from vehicular traffic.

The name of Saint CHRISTOPHERUS, to whom this church in Oese is dedicated, translates to "Christ-bearer". According to the traditional legend of the saints, he was a giant-like man and carried people across a river. One day a small child called him, and he carried it on his shoulders to the other bank. Surprisingly, the child became heavier and heavier for him, and he said he felt as if the weight of the whole world was resting on his shoulders. Then the child revealed itself to him as Jesus Christ, the savior and redeemer of the world.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many traffic-free gravel bike trails can I find around Alfstedt?

There are currently 5 traffic-free gravel bike routes available around Alfstedt on komoot. These routes offer a great way to explore the region's diverse landscapes without vehicle interference.

Are there any easy, traffic-free gravel routes su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, several routes are rated as easy. For a pleasant, family-friendly ride, consider the Rest Area at Hohen Oerel – Small pond with sandy beach loop from Bremervörde. It's just over 20 km long and features minimal elevation gain, making it ideal for a relaxed outing.

What kind of landscapes can I expect on these traffic-free gravel trails?

The traffic-free gravel trails around Alfstedt traverse the picturesque North German lowlands, including the 'Geest' landscape. You'll experience a mix of sandy paths, forests, heathland, and agricultural areas. The region is particularly known for its tranquil river valleys, such as the Oste, and unique moor landscapes, offering diverse surfaces perfect for gravel biking.

Are there any circular traffic-free gravel routes around Alfstedt?

Yes, all the traffic-free gravel routes listed are circular. For example, the Lake Vörder – Vörder Lake loop from Hönau-Lindorf offers a scenic 30 km ride around the beautiful Vörder Lake, providing a complete loop experience.

What are some interesting sights or attractions along the traffic-free gravel routes?

Many routes offer opportunities to see local attractions. You could cycle past the spectacular Vörder Lake and Nature & Adventure Park Bremervörde, or explore unique natural monuments like the Petrified Mammoth Tree. The region also features charming shelters like the Shelter at the Ostede, perfect for a short break.

Are there any challenging traffic-free gravel routes for experienced riders?

Yes, for those seeking a more challenging ride, the Lake Bederkesa – Lake Bederkesa loop from Mittelstenahe is rated as difficult. This route spans nearly 48 km with over 100 meters of elevation gain, offering a good workout while remaining traffic-free.

Can I find routes that incorporate unique regional experiences, like ferry crossings?

Absolutely! The Großes Moor – Prahmfähre Gräpel loop from Estorf is a fantastic option. This route includes a crossing on the unique, engine-free Gräpel Oste Ferry, operated by muscle power, adding an adventurous and historic element to your gravel ride through the moor landscape.

What do other gravel bikers say about the traffic-free routes in Alfstedt?

The komoot community highly rates the routes around Alfstedt, with an average score of 5.0 stars. Riders often praise the tranquility of the paths, the beautiful natural scenery, and the joy of exploring the region without encountering vehicle traffic.

Are there any routes that pass by lakes or offer water views?

Yes, the region is home to several beautiful lakes. The Lake Vörder – Vörder Lake loop from Hönau-Lindorf is an excellent choice, offering continuous views of Vörder Lake. Another option is the Lake Bederkesa – Lake Bederkesa loop from Mittelstenahe, which circles the scenic Lake Bederkesa.

Where can I find parking for these traffic-free gravel bike trails?

Many of these routes start from towns or villages like Bremervörde, Estorf, or Mittelstenahe, where public parking is generally available. For specific starting points and parking information, it's best to check the individual route details on komoot, as they often include precise trailhead locations.

What is the typical duration for a traffic-free gravel bike ride in this area?

The duration varies depending on the route length and your pace. Rides range from approximately 1 hour 15 minutes for shorter routes like the Rest Area at Hohen Oerel – Small pond with sandy beach loop from Bremervörde (20 km) to over 2 hours 30 minutes for longer, more challenging options such as the Lake Bederkesa – Lake Bederkesa loop from Mittelstenahe (48 km).
